Harrison joins Iowa State Bank

FAIRFIELD — Aaron Kness, President and CEO of Iowa State Bank, announced that Troy Harrison has joined the Iowa State Bank team as new Vice President of Lending.
Aaron commented, “I’m impressed with Troy’s knowledge and character. He takes time to understand his customers’ needs and works hard to fulfill them. Troy’s commitment to the people and communities we serve fits Iowa State Bank’s culture perfectly.”
Troy comes to the bank with almost 10 years of experience in the banking industry, specializing in agricultural and commercial lending. He is a graduate of the University of Northern Iowa with a bachelor’s degree in Real Estate and Financial Management.
Troy is actively involved with the Fairfield Lions Club. In his free time, he enjoys working on his classic cars and walking local trails with his dog.
Jared Lyle, Iowa State Bank’s Senior Vice President, added, “Troy understands community banking and how vital it is to southeast Iowa. This background, along with his dynamic credit skills, will make him a great asset to our organization and the businesses we serve.”
About Iowa State Bank
Iowa State Bank & Trust Company opened its doors for the first time on May 19, 1934, after a merger between Iowa State Savings Bank and the Iowa Loan and Trust Company. Over the last 88 years, the bank has been dedicated to serving southeast Iowans. The bank is well known for leading projects focused on the arts, education, athletics, and a wide variety of charitable activities. Today, Iowa State Bank & Trust Company has grown to an institution with more than $180 million in assets.
